The RadiolinkRC4GS V3 is a state-of-the-art 5-channel RC transmitter and receiver designed for serious hobbyists. With advanced features like a built-in gyro, extensive telemetry capabilities, and the ability to store up to 30 models, this remote controller is perfect for RC crawlers, drifting cars, and more. Its robust anti-interference technology ensures reliable performance, making it a must-have for any RC enthusiast.

Almost perfect
This is my first radio that can be used for multiple RC cars. AKA not the RTR radio that it comes with. I want to give it 5 stars but there's a couple issues with this radio that cannot be overlooked. The radio is decent quality and the features are excellent for the price. I will never be able to live without exponential steering ever again. I have MS and this is a game changer reducing my twitchy movements down the straightaways. Interface is easy to navigate. Layout and feel of the transmitter and steering wheel is good.Now for the gripes: I wish they built it without the external antenna. How much extra range does a couple inch antenna really add? This radio is for my track cars only and I definitely don't need it. It's annoying it's flimsy and susceptible to breaking I already had to return one radio because it snapped and just went around in circles. They could build these with no external antenna they would work just as good and be much more durable. The second issue is the cover for the batteries it is very flimsy and the batteries tend to pop down and occasionally the radio will shut itself off. A beefier battery cover or a better designed cover would remedy this.Receivers are cheap enough I bought two of these radios one for the girlfriend's car s. 2 radios and about 10 receivers and I'm in for less than $300 with tax. Compare that to spectrum or futaba or similar and it's a big difference.Overall a great radio with a few flaws I would buy them again I just wish they would change those couple things and they would be "perfect" radios for the price.

The best system available today. Bar None.
I've had this system for 6 years now and have 12 RC's controlled by it. By NAME. The only problem is, you can only run one at a time, obviously. The "dial a gyro" on the side of the controller is pure genus. I started building 10th scale street cars that could go 100mph and that's why I looked into the Radio Link. They needed the gyro's to stay on the road. And with the steering rate still turned down. I wouldn't have anything else. Some cars that I let others drive I put stand alone gyros in them. If you have a decent front end alignment, the gyro will make your car go straight as an arrow on any terrain. Jumps are a thing of beauty. All your cars will last longer because you won't crash them near as much as you do now. The gyro is the tits. I can't believe the tech is as slow as it was 6 years ago. You'd think all cars just would come with them by now. We only need three axis, the oldest gyro tech there is. I highly recommend this system.
